Saint Anselm College was founded in 1889 by the Benedictine monks of St. Mary’s Abbey of Newark, New Jersey, in response to the invitation by Bishop Denis M. Bradley, the first bishop of Manchester, N.H. A six-year classical course, with curricula in philosophical and theological studies, was organized and opened to qualified students. In 1895, the General Court of the State of New Hampshire empowered Saint Anselm to grant standard academic degrees. From its beginning, the college is a small private non-profit college dedicated to delivering a first-class, liberal arts education.

How to Apply
All the students first take admission in the college. Interested applicants should fill the FAFSA using the school code: 002587. Candidates need to complete the CSS Profile without failure. For completing CSS, students should use school code: 3748. After the CSS profile is submitted, the student will be emailed login information for IDOC directly from the college board. All the applications should be submitted before the deadlines. Late or incomplete application will lead to rejection of your financial aid.
